首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将R中包含额外信息的列转换为日期格式

在R中将包含额外信息的列转换为日期格式,可以使用as.Date()函数。首先,我们需要了解额外信息的格式,并提取出日期信息。然后,使用as.Date()函数将提取的日期信息转换为日期格式。

以下是将包含额外信息的列转换为日期格式的步骤:

  1. 确定额外信息的格式:额外信息可能以不同的形式存在,例如"YYYY-MM-DD"、"MM/DD/YYYY"等。在转换之前,需要先确定额外信息的格式。
  2. 提取日期信息:使用字符串处理函数(如substr()gsub()等)或正则表达式(如grepl()regexpr()等)从额外信息中提取日期部分。
  3. 使用as.Date()函数将日期信息转换为日期格式:根据提取的日期部分和额外信息的格式,使用as.Date()函数将其转换为日期格式。

以下是一个示例代码,将格式为"YYYY-MM-DD"的额外信息列转换为日期格式:

代码语言:txt
复制
# 假设额外信息列名为extra_info,包含格式为"YYYY-MM-DD"的日期信息
extra_info <- c("2022-08-01", "2022-08-02", "2022-08-03")

# 提取日期信息
date_part <- substr(extra_info, 1, 10)

# 将日期信息转换为日期格式
date_format <- as.Date(date_part)

# 输出转换后的日期格式
print(date_format)

以上代码将输出转换后的日期格式:

代码语言:txt
复制
[1] "2022-08-01" "2022-08-02" "2022-08-03"

在腾讯云中,相关产品可以使用腾讯云云服务器(CVM)和云数据库(TencentDB)进行开发和部署。腾讯云云服务器提供强大的计算能力和网络支持,适用于各种应用场景。云数据库(TencentDB)提供高可用性、弹性扩展和自动备份等功能,适用于存储和管理大量数据。

腾讯云云服务器产品介绍链接地址:https://cloud.tencent.com/product/cvm

腾讯云云数据库产品介绍链接地址:https://cloud.tencent.com/product/cdb

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的合辑

领券